Spoke on Software Development Models/Methodologies
We are extremely pleased to report that Mr. T. Sekar was part of a NASSCOM workshop on Software Quality where he presented a talk to the faculty at VIT on the topic "Overview: SDLC models/methodologies". The workshop was held on the 29th of Feb 2008 and the 1st of March. He covered the various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C) methodologies and also detailed their usage and application scenarios in the present industry context.
Alongside Sekar, there were speakers from other IT majors like Accenture, Virtusa, Cognizant, Polaris, Infosys and Wipro Technologies.
The Objective of the Forum:
The Faculty Development Workshop on Software Quality was jointly organized by NASSCOM and VIT University. The NASSCOM Industry-Academia Task Force of the Chennai Q Group endeavored to fulfill the gap between the Software Quality concepts and Maturity levels of Professionals in industry vis-à-vis what is taught and imbibed in Colleges and Universities across India. As part of this Software Quality Workshop, the Task Force conducted a series of sessions in various aspects of Software Quality Management. As per their expectation, these gave an overview of the Software Quality Scenario in the Indian and, where relevant, global scenario and bridge the Industry-Academia gap in this space in an incremental manner.
